Local councils across the UK are increasingly at odds with government mandates, as new findings expose a growing trend of resistance to development projects. Despite clear directives from ministers to approve various planning applications, numerous town halls are choosing to disregard these instructions, raising concerns over the implications for housing and infrastructure.

A Growing Trend of Defiance

The latest investigation has unveiled that a significant number of councils are rejecting planning proposals that should have been approved, according to government guidelines. This trend highlights a worrying disconnect between local authorities and central government, marking a departure from the cooperative spirit intended to address the country’s pressing housing crisis.

Councils are reported to be declining applications for residential buildings, commercial developments, and essential infrastructure upgrades, leading to delays and increased costs for developers. The data reveals that these decisions are not merely isolated incidents but represent a systemic issue affecting numerous regions.

Financial Implications and Delays

The financial ramifications of these planning decisions are profound. Developers often face escalating costs due to prolonged approval processes, which can lead to budget overruns and deter potential investments. The current resistance to planning approvals not only hinders growth but also places additional strain on local economies already battling the effects of the pandemic.

Moreover, the delays in housing developments contribute to the ongoing housing shortage, exacerbating affordability issues for many families. The government’s aim to increase housing supply seems increasingly jeopardised as councils continue to impose unreasonable barriers.

The Role of Community Sentiment

Community opposition is frequently cited as a primary reason for councils rejecting planning applications. Local residents often raise concerns about potential developments impacting their quality of life, leading to a tense atmosphere between councils and developers. This local pushback can sway council decisions, creating a complex interplay between public sentiment and government policy.

However, while community concerns are valid, the broader implications of stalling development cannot be overlooked. The balance between preserving local character and addressing the urgent need for housing must be carefully navigated.
